This is for Chapter 23 of ~Eien-no-Basho's "Behind the Silk Screen." I'm super pleased with how easily this piece came together; usually I paint one day and then let it sit for a bit before inking it, but I didn't have time to do that this time, but I think it turned out well anyway. The palette's a bit more muted than usual, but I thought that was appropriate for the water theme.
Here's the scene:
"Well, we've been travelling along it for weeks without any sign of them," Kagome said thoughtfully. "Where exactly in the river do they live? And how do we go about requesting an audience with them?"
Kouga paused for a moment, blinking as he considered this. At last he shrugged.
"Dunno," he said. "I've never had to deal directly with 'em before. Our territories don't intersect and they're not much involved in youkai clan squabbles, as far as I know."
"Oh," Kagome said, frowning. "Then…what should we do?"
She had studied enough of ryū to know that they dwelt inside the rivers themselves, but little beyond that. Nor has she ever seen one personally, though she knew that they were ancient and supposedly very wise. Beyond that she was at a loss.
Kouga raised his free hand to scratch idly at the back of his head, frowning out at the river. He shrugged once more.
"Why not just call?" he suggested.
"Call?" Kagome echoed, glancing incredulously at him.
He nodded, moving a few steps down the river bank. He cupped his free hand around his mouth.
"Oi!" he hollered at the water, voice loud enough to startle nearby birds into flight. "This is Kouga, head of the Eastern Wolf Clan. I wanna talk to the head of the Ryū Clan!"
Kagome blinked, staring at him in disbelief. Silence reigned in the wake of his shouting, only the trickling rush of the water audible.
Kouga frowned down at the water, obviously having been confident that it would work. He glanced back at her, expression vaguely petulant with disappointment. Kagome choked back a laugh.
"Guess not," he muttered, moving back up towards her.
Kagome laughed aloud then. His pout intensified.
"It…it was a good effort, Kouga-sama," she said placatingly between breathless chuckles. "I just don't think-"
A low rumbling stopped her short. Both turned back to the river, Kagome's eyes widening as she watched the current of the river shift and reverse. Suddenly she could sense it, like a flame sparking to life in her sixth sense. The youki was massive and ancient and somehow wise.
The thing emerged, serpentine, water rolling down off its scales in great falls as it rose from somewhere beyond the deepest depths of the river-bed. Golden eyes turned languidly towards them, white-scaled body twisting slowly to follow, and Kouga shifted to stand protectively in front of Kagome. A stretch of silence ensued in which the three eyed one another, though Kagome and Kouga with much more obvious interest than the ryū.
"You called?" the ryū spoke at last, though somehow without appearing to move its mouth in the slightest.
